If you want to match the front scuff pads, do what a lot of others do. Buy two new front pads from the dealer, trim them a bit, cut off the small nipples on the bottom and glue or 3M them on at the rear door sills. If you can't do the trimming yourself, a good neighbor or someone you know who's handy with tools can help you.
